Minutes — Management Meeting, Harwick Components

Attendees reviewed the warranty-cost overrun on the Ferrox valve series, now 38% above the annual provision. Root cause was traced to a seal supplier change made in spring. Marisa Quent will lead a claims audit; Dalton Reeve will renegotiate supplier recovery terms. Sales leads are asked to hold pricing steady pending the audit. The remediation timeline depends on a decision recorded in the note below.

internal memo for yajop-tahog: Fradorox Group plans to raise the Fravan list price by 8.6 percent in June. The pricing group signed off on a budget of $133.1 million for Project Pelmir. The renewal with Caswynek Partners closes at $416.4 million a year, 19.7 percent below the last contract. Project Norael slips by six weeks because of the supplier delay.

Key ceremony checklist, item 7 — Almsworth ReceiptPost

For external plugin authors: before your plugin can sign donation receipts through the ReceiptPost mailer, attend the quarterly key ceremony. Confirm two witnesses are present, verify the signing HSM serial against the ceremony record, and check that the previous signing key has been marked retired. Plugins must re-register their callback manifests afterward. Once the witnesses sign off, unseal the ceremony envelope using the recovery passphrase below.

unlock words, kagef-taduf: fenir-quenix-norwyn-sorvan-gormir-gorir-fraok

MEMO — Headcount Plan, Next Fiscal Year

To: Sales Leads
From: Ilsa Brenmark, Director of Commercial Operations

Please review carefully. We are approved for nine additional sales roles: five in the Tarvel region, four supporting the Quillon product group. Backfills require my sign-off. Hiring pauses automatically if Q2 bookings fall below plan. Territory assignments follow in a separate note. The underlying strategic reasoning appears directly below.

board note of bawep-tajef: Queniusek Systems plans to raise the Quenvan list price by 53.1 percent in March. The pricing group signed off on a budget of $176.4 million for Project Drueth. The renewal with Casionix Partners closes at $142.5 million a year, 8.3 percent below the last contract. Project Fraax slips by six weeks because of the tooling delay.